A delegation of Chechnya led by Ramzan Kadyrov arrived in Uzbekistan

Tashkent, Uzbekistan (UzDaily.com) -- The head of Chechnya Ramzan Kadyrov arrived in Uzbekistan on 26 May to participate in a meeting of the Council of Regions of Russia and Uzbekistan with the participation of the leaders of the two countries - Vladimir Putin and Shavkat Mirziyoyev.

It should be noted that the meeting of the Council of Regions of Russia and Uzbekistan is being held for the first time. It takes place as part of the state visit of Russian President Vladimir Putin to Uzbekistan.

Prime Minister of Uzbekistan Abdulla Aripov met with Ramzan Kadyrov.

During the meeting, Abdulla Aripov noted the strategic nature of the partnership between the two countries, achieved thanks to the political will of Vladimir Putin and Shavkat Mirziyoyev.

The head of the government of Uzbekistan emphasized that friendly relations have long existed between the two peoples, which must be preserved and developed.

Ramzan Kadyrov noted that Chechens perceive Uzbekistan especially warmly, since the First President of Chechnya, Hero of Russia Akhmat-Khadzhi Kadyrov studied there.

“Our peoples have long treated each other as brothers. Otherwise it can not be. I expressed confidence that the meeting of the Council of Regions of Russia and Uzbekistan under the leadership of Vladimir Putin and Shavkat Mirziyoyev will give a powerful impetus to the further development of partnership and friendship between our countries,” Kadyrov emphasized.

“I am sincerely glad that the leaders of our countries are aimed at strengthening relations. I am confident that our joint work will take regional cooperation between Russia and Uzbekistan to a new level and will contribute to the achievement of mutually beneficial cooperation,” added the head of Chechnya.
